Stallings: Gonzales visit to Idaho doesn't make up for abuse of office

Monday, June 25, 2007


Contact:  Chuck Oxley   (208) 871-4976 (office)  

 

BOISE, Idaho – The following remarks were made Monday by Richard Stallings, chairman of the Idaho Democratic Party and former 2nd District congressman:

 

“United States Attorney General Alberto Gonzales will be visiting Boise on Tuesday. While his stated intention is to meet local and tour facilities, it’s clear that the trip is really just an attempt to rehabilitate the AG’s appalling image.

 

“The intermountain West is known to be more friendly to president Bush than some areas of the country, but we are not so blind that we do not see how powerful individuals like Gonzales have abused their position to take away people’s basic and essential rights to privacy and ` the pursuit of happiness.’”

 

Senate Republicans recently blocked a no-confidence resolution against Gonzales, but it’s clear that he no longer has the confidence of a majority of the Senate -- or of the American people. 

 

“His attempt to obfuscate the truth about the firings of U.S. Attorneys around the country shows he is either stonewalling or he has become completely detached from the day to day work of the Department of Justice. 

 

The dedicated people in the U.S. Attorney's office for the District of Idaho work hard to administer justice in a fair and even-handed manner.  The people of our state and nation deserve nothing less. Unfortunately, however, the Attorney General seems not to understand that he took an oath to serve the Republic, not the Republican Party. 

 

“Time and time again, he has put partisanship before citizenship, undermining confidence in our justice system. During his tenure with the Bush administration, Gonzalez has done more to take away the rights and liberties of the people of this country than perhaps any other Attorney General in history.

 

“All the softball news stories and photo ops in the world will never be enough to compensate for cronyism, concealment and corruption that has come from Alberto Gonzales. In the end, his legacy will be the rampant and shameful abuse off office.”
